I chose "True Beauty" by Mandisa to represent Inner Beauty. This song is stating that the fancy
and expensive things such as Designer names, surgeries, tans etc... are not as that important compared to other things. This is represented well when the song says "The passion and the purpose that's burning down inside us is really what we need to see, doesn't come in a bottle, doesn't come in a box, you can't spray it on, you can't wash it off, you can't nip and tuck, you can't sew it up. Also "the hands that made the moon and stars, the mountains and the seas made you wonderful, beautiful, marvelously, let the whole world see your true beauty." This gives more of a religious perspective but even if you're not religious, I think that this song is saying that everyone was made differently and everyone has their own kind of beauty in them. Let people see who you are without all those things on the outside, "skin is just the surface."
